PHP to drop individual plans from “Obamacare” marketplace

FORT WAYNE, Ind. (WOWO): A Fort Wayne-based insurance provider is dropping out of the Affordable Care Act.

Physicians Health Plan of Northern Indiana, otherwise known as PHP, says it won’t be selling individual insurance policies through the government’s marketplace anymore, saying they have lost millions of dollars on policies they’ve been made to sell as part of the so-called “Obamacare” exchanges.

PHP claims it pays $1.20 for every dollar it gets from the marketplace, and it cannot keep absorbing the loss, although the company will keep selling small group insurance plans through the ACA.
